Founder CEO 

William Ramos 

DJ / Producer

 WallstreetWillie

 
Will was born in the south bronx and raised 
in the  Kingsbridge 
/ Fordham Rd section of the Bronx, 
NYC, his musical journey began 
when he attended a block party 
organized by his neighbor the 
legendary DJ Breakbeat Lou,
 co-founder of Ultimate Breaks & Beats. 

From 1993 to 1998, 

Will showcased his DJ skills at NYC’s iconic

 Webster Hall playing open format and

 classic tracks, captivating a diverse 

crowd of hipsters. 

In 1998, Will embarked on an internship 

at Big East Ent. Group Inc., a 

prominent entertainment company.

 One of their subsidiary labels was 

the legendary indie label B-Boy Records,

 home to OG, artists such as

 KRS 1, JVC Force  Sparky dee,

 Grand Master Caz, and others.

 Will’s dedication and expertise 

quickly propelled him from an intern to 

a paid position as a studio manager. 

He excelled in various roles, including 

marketing and promotion, intellectual 

property management, and identifying 

instances of unauthorized sampling 

within the labels catalog

eventually, he rose through the 

ranks to become the President 

of the company

after the passing of the original 

owner, Ira Jack Allen.

B- Boy had a catalog of pioneering

 older artist but nothing new. 
Following the unfortunate passing 

of Milton Turner, the CFO Will made 

the difficult decision to leave his position 

at B-Boy Records. 
In 2011, Will, was contracted to be 

an assistant to Tim Olphie, the CEO of VIBE 

Records, a pioneering publicly traded independent 

record label based in Nevada. 

At VIBE, Will showcased his versatility

 by creating impactful marketing materials, 

including radio one-sheets electronic 

press kits  (E.P.Ks), for various 

artists  including former

 Teror Squad artist Tony Sunshine the late 

Big pun’s singing protege

Additionally, Will handled marketing 

responsibilities for Off The Hook Models, 

a subsidiary of VIBE Records.

 In 2012, Will founded Big Willie Ent. Group Inc.,

 a Delaware corporation focused on 

artist development & promoting nightclubs 

in NYC. More information about 

his events can be found on 

the website www.bigwillieent.com/ events.

 William Ramos has dedicated over 

three decades of his life to the 

music industry, workin tireless

 behind the scenes making his passion 

for music his purpose.

GREG LAWRENCE
MUSIC INDUSTRY CONSULTANT / AUDIO ENGINEER

Greg Lawrence started his musical journey at 18 years
old playing bass with his child hood friend hip hops
first Super Producer the late Larry Smith, credits
RUN DMC WHOODINI, FLASH, FAT BOYS,
Jimmy Spicer, Kurtis Blow Orange crush & others. In 1985 Greg and his lawyer a brilliant investor formed
PRO JAM Recording Studio Located on
sugar hill 145 & Amsterdam
NY NY For 12 years Greg, served hip-hops
finest from THE LOX Big L, to DMX, Buck Wild
DJ S&S, DJ Doowop, & an array of other
notable rappers musicians DJs & artist. From 1996 till present Greg has held a Position
at RUFF RYDER Recording studio. In 2015 Greg founded GEES, ROOM,
RECORDING, With clients like
Murda Mook Uncle Murda & other notable
musicians singers & rappers. Greg, has created archives of
remarkable memories & milestones
in 40 + years of working in HipHop culture.
